Knife Foxes

The Knife Foxes are Nad Greentail’s pirate crew of miscreants. Many are deserters, drifters, and drudges from seedy corners of the world seeking easy fortune.

When not arguing with their self-appointed Tanuki Captain, they bumble around, hoping to catch victims unaware with their knives.

In this blog post, I talk about the long process drawing these knife fox bandits from paper to digital screen!
